Nite Ch."PR"Misty River Ramblin Blue Smoke

Thursday Morning Jeremy and I loaded up Smoke and traveled to Batesville, Ms. to the BBOA National Bluetick Hunt. Thursday night we hunted in the all Blue hunt. Smoke did good. We drew two more good hunters with good dogs. We had a good hunt, but mostly cold tracks ending in den trees.
Friday night things looked better. We drew a good place. We had an English, walker, Bluetick female and Smoke. The man with the English withdrew as soon as we got to the woods. He said he had to go to work early the next morning and left. The other 3 dogs went hunting. Smoke wound up the winner with 650+ points
Saturday Night we drew another good cast in a good spot. We had 2 male blueticks and a female walker and a Black and tan female. smoke led the cast until the last turn loose. Smoke got deep and had not struck. The walker and black and tan got treed Smoke came back and backed them. The tree was slick. The other bluetick got treed separate and had a coon and won the cast. The guy with the other bluetick is a good guy with a good dog, but I can not remember his name. We really enjoyed the weekend.

Snake bite

Tommy I'm sure it was some kind of water Moccasin. he was in those sloughs a lot. I know it was not a Rattle Snake. Those big boys play for keeps. Chris almost stepped on a big cottonmouth. I borrowed one of the guys machettie and killed it. I told Chris he had learned a new dance(The Crawfish). He liked to have ran over the rest of us backing out of there. I haven't seen any Rattle Snakes yet, so I don't know about them, but it looks like the Moccasins are going to be bad this year. A lot of the time a Rattle Snake will try to get out of your way and a lot of the time unless you just step on him will warn you by rattling that you are getting too close, but those moccasins will come and get you. Tommy you can pick the Benedryl up at any drug store. There is also a shot that you can keep in your truck for a snake bite. I don't know the name of it, but I keep some in my truck. Jerry Wheat gave me some a while back. I don't know how long the shot will keep in you truck. I'm going to check with a vet as soon as possible on this.

Smoke


Posted by Misty river on 06-07-2016 07:51 AM:

Smoke

My neighbor came by about dark tonight and we loaded smoke up and headed to the swamp. Turned him off an ole woods road into a wet bottom. He went in about 250 yrds and struck a cold track and started working it. he moved in about another 300 yrds and treed. We went around on another road and he was only about 100 yrds from us. We walked in to him and he was treed at the edge of a pretty deep drain that runs through the swamp. I could only shine one side of the the big gum tree that he was treed up. There was a lot of high grass and bushes up and down both sides of the drain and it looked like there could have been all kinds of snakes in there so I decided not to try to cross the drain. This is the same area where Smoke got snake bit about a week ago and Chris almost stepped on one. We shined the one side for a few minutes and leashed Smoke and moved on down the swamp. Turned him into another part of the swamp and he went in 400 yrds and struck another cold track and started working it. Worked it in another 300 yrds and we decided we had better catch up some. We rode into about 150 yrds of him and sat an listened. he had worked into the sunken swamp. He trailed toward us to about 75 yrds and then turned and trailed away from us to about 200 yrds and locked up treed. We walked in to him and he was treed up a large oak. I walked to a small clearing where I could see the tree pretty good and when I hit the squaller he looked at me. It had been a while since I had let smoke have one so we let him have this one. Smoke toted the coon back to the 4-wheeler like he usually does and we called it a night.
